The problem with Poch selecting Kane wasn't whether Kane was fit or not or deserved to start or not. It was whether he was match sharp enough to beat VVD and Alisson and displace a semi-final hat-trick winning hero who had pace and could tactically cause Liverpool problems, in my opinion. The jury is still out on that one because we lost, which we knew before the game, but one thing I will give Pochettino credit for is he believed in his best XI on paper and gave all of his forward players a chance.

You can say he got the order wrong, and I believe he did and said so before the match, but I don't think there is anyone who didn't change their mind four or five times.
